National Library Mariano Moreno
National Library Mariano Moreno is a library in Comuna 2, Buenos Aires, Buenos Aires which is located on Agüero. National Library Mariano Moreno is situated nearby to the college National School of Librarians, as well as near Patio de Lectura.Photo: Aleksandrs Timofejev…, CC BY 3.0.

National Museum of Fine Arts
Museum
Photo: Beatrice Murch, CC BY-SA 2.0.
The National Museum of Fine Arts is an Argentine art museum in Buenos Aires, located in the Recoleta section of the city. The Museum inaugurated a branch in Neuquén in 2004. National Museum of Fine Arts is situated 470 metres east of National Library Mariano Moreno.

Recoleta
Suburb
Photo: WiDi,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Recoleta is a barrio or neighborhood of Buenos Aires, Argentina, located in the northern part of the city, by the Río de la Plata. The area is perhaps best known to be the home of the distinguished Recoleta Cemetery.
